KOTA KINABALU: There is a pressing need to adopt the anti-hopping law in Sabah to ensure political stability in the state, says a Parti Warisan assemblyman.
Tungku rep Assafal Alian said the state government must table the anti-party hopping law, more so after the political crisis that unfolded in the state over the week.
